    DATABASE TECHNOLOGY FOR LIFE SCIENCES AND MEDICINE

    edited by Claudia Plant (Technische Universität München, Germany) & Christian Böhm (Ludwig-Maximilians Universität München, Germany)

    This book presents innovative approaches from database researchers supporting the challenging process of knowledge discovery in biomedicine. Ranging from how to effectively store and organize biomedical data via data quality and case studies to sophisticated data mining methods, this book provides the state-of-the-art of database technology for life sciences and medicine.

    A valuable source of information for experts in life sciences who want to be updated about the possibilities of database technology in their field, this volume will also be inspiring for students and researchers in informatics who are keen to contribute to this emerging field of interdisciplinary research.

     
    Contents:
    • Biomedical Databases and Data Mining
    • DYNASTAT: A Methodology for Modeling of Multiagent Systems
    • SciPort: An Extensible Data Management Platform for Biomedical Research
    • An Integrative Framework for Anonymizing Clinical and Genomic Data
    • Data Integration Challenges: A Systems Biology Perpsective
    • Ontology-Based Data Integration: A Case Study in Clinical Trials
    • A Data Warehouse for Ca. Glomeribacter Gigasporarum Bacterium
    • Quality of Medical Data: A Case Study
    • Efficient EMD-Based Similarity Search in Medical Image Databases
    • Fast Multimedia Querying for Medical Applications
    • Ensemble Feature Selection in Biomedical Applications
    • Analysis of Breast Cancer Geonomic Data by Fuzzy Association Rule Mining
    • Graph Mining on Brain Co-Activation Networks
    • Automatic Identification of Surgery Indicators
    • Incremental Learning of Medical Data for Multi-Step Patient Health Classification
     
    Readership: Professionals, researchers and academics in databases, artificial intelligence, bioinformatics and pattern recognition.
